The City of Philadelphia, MS Philadelphia is a city in and the county seat of Neshoba County, Mississippi, United States.

The region of Neshoba county and the surrounding counties was the heart of the Choctaw Nation from the 17th century until removal of most of the people in the 1830s. European-American settlers began to arrive in numbers in the early decades of the nineteenth century, after French, British and Spanish traders developed business relationships with the Choctaw.

🚧 TRAFFIC ALERT 🚧

A partial roundabout opening and traffic flow change is now in place. Earlier today, Mayor Jim Fulton drove through the intersection and witnessed an incident involving drivers not properly following the stop and yield signs. Because this traffic pattern is new to all of us, we are asking everyone to please slow down, stay alert, and pay close attention when approaching this area.

⚠️ IMPORTANT UPDATE:
The portion of the roundabout where Lakeside Drive connects previously had a stop sign while the area was being used as a detour. That stop sign has now been removed, and Lakeside Drive traffic now has the right-of-way in that area. Please be aware of this change and pay close attention when entering the intersection.

Please take a moment to study the graphic below before driving through the intersection. A few extra seconds of caution can help prevent accidents and keep everyone safe.

Here are a few important reminders:

🛑 STOP SIGN:
A stop sign means you must come to a complete stop. Look both ways, wait until traffic is clear or until you have the right-of-way, and then proceed carefully.

⚠️ YIELD SIGN:
A yield sign means drivers should slow down and yield to traffic already moving through the intersection or roundabout. If traffic is clear, you may continue without stopping. If another vehicle has the right-of-way, wait until it is safe to proceed.

⚠️ WEATHER ALERT ⚠️

The National Weather Service in Jackson has placed Philadelphia and the surrounding area under an Enhanced Risk (Level 3) for severe weather this afternoon through tonight.

This means:
• Storms are likely
• Tornadoes, including the possibility of strong tornadoes
• Damaging wind gusts up to 70 mph
• Large hail up to golf ball size

We strongly encourage all residents to take precautions and remain weather aware throughout the day and evening. Please make sure your phones are charged, flashlights and batteries are ready, and you have a plan in place in case severe weather impacts our area.

🚧 Traffic Update Reminder for Philadelphia Residents 🚧

The Mississippi Department of Transportation has notified the City of Philadelphia of major traffic changes beginning Monday, May 4th at the Highway 15/16 roundabout project.

If your daily commute is affected, please plan ahead and allow extra time.

Here’s what to expect:
• Highway 16 at West Beacon Street will reopen
• Highway 15 will be closed between SR-885 and Lakeside Drive
• The connection from Lakeside Drive to SR-16 will open

This traffic pattern will remain in place from May 4th through November 1st.

🚦 Detour route signage and temporary traffic signals will be in place to help guide drivers.
